Landscape Photography Settings | How to Set the Focus

    https://iceland-photo-tours.com/articles/photography-techniques/landscape-photography-settings-how-to-set-the-focus
    By keeping your aperture as close to the sweet spot as possible, you’ll be able to easily ensure that you take sharply focused photos of the landscape during your time in Iceland. Although the sweet spot can vary between lenses, it generally lies between two and three stops out from the maximum aperture of your lens.

How to Focus in Landscape Photography

    https://photographylife.com/landscapes/how-to-focus-landscape-photography
    All you need to do is focus at “double the distance” – twice as far away as the closest object in your photo. If the closest object in your photo is …

4 Strategies for Perfecting the Focus in Your Landscape …

    https://www.photographytalk.com/landscape-photography/7164-4-strategies-for-perfecting-the-focus-in-your-landscape-photos
    The procedure is simple: compose the shot as you desire, and set your aperture to your lens’ sweet spot. Focus on a point perhaps one-third from the bottom of the frame and take the photo. Then, move your focal point upward, to perhaps the horizontal midline, and take another photo, ensuring that the composition remains precisely the same.

Hyperfocal Distance Tips for Landscape Photographers

    https://visualwilderness.com/fieldwork/hyperfocal-distance-tips-for-landscape-photographers
    However, landscape photographers should remember an important fact. Every camera lens has its own sweet spot where the performance of the lens is optimal. For most lenses, the performance is optimal between F5.6 and F11 apertures. Once you start using your lenses outside this aperture range, lens performance degrades.
